Output d20af5ccf727f2307ee1f2681038856489cd49decb913360bb635e84d7903fd6:0

value
949996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524a1a07e1710d36142d3b001bdb26d0eba03292 OP_EQUAL
address
39C86wznQ7SvTere7K9ByCWQJMK367VS5y
transaction
d20af5ccf727f2307ee1f2681038856489cd49decb913360bb635e84d7903fd6
confirmations
11976
spent
true